Police organizes training for Gazetted officers and SHOs on Unlawful Activities Prevention Act in Budgam
FacebookTwitterWhatsappTelegram

January 10:“`In its endeavour to promote professional capacity building and skill upgradation, police in Budgam today organized a training program on Unlawful Activities Prevention Act.

The program was chaired by SSP Budgam Shri Al Tahir Gilani-JKPS. In the two-session program, the resource person for the first session was CPO Mr. Salim Wani who deliberated on the topic ” Legal aspects of UAPA”. He touched upon various important legal nuances related to the investigation and Prosecution under the Act and also spoke in detail about the common problems faced while adhering to technical requirements under the Act and examination of witnesses during Prosecution.

SDPO Chrar-i-Sharif Shri Owais Wani-JKPS, was the resource person for the second session. He deliberated upon the “Practical aspects of Investigation under UAPA”. He explained the practical difficulties faced by the Investigating Officer while investigating crimes under this Act. He also threw light on various chapters and sections of the Act and how to best utilize the same.

Pertinently, the training program was attended by all Gazetted officers of the district including ASP Budgam Shri Raghav S.-IPS, Shri Ajaz Malik-JKPS, SDPO KhanSahib Shri Gh. Mohuidin, all SHOs etc.“`
